Ferrari's world champion Kimi Raikkonen will lead the way when Formula One returns to Barcelona this weekend for the first race of the season in Europe. The Finn is top of the standings after the first three long-haul races, a novel sensation for a driver who won his title by clawing back a 17-point deficit in the last two rounds of 2007.

Lewis Hamilton said he had let down McLaren after a starting grid error cost him and his team the Formula One championship lead in Bahrain on Sunday. The Briton finished 13th at Sakhir and was overtaken in the standings by Ferrari's world champion Kimi Raikkonen.
